Solution Design

Integration design for this pair establishes Fulfil as the authoritative source for inventory and purchase orders, while Prediko serves as the demand-modelling layer. We typically establish a specific sequencing for sales velocity into Prediko to influence purchasing signals in Fulfil. A key design decision often involves using scheduled batch syncs for historical data. This is a deliberate trade-off because batch processing is generally more resilient for large catalogues and easier to reconcile during high-volume periods. The resulting model ensures finance can close the month based on Fulfil stock valuation, while operations executes purchasing derived from Prediko forecasts. This helps ensure that purchasing decisions are based on unified data rather than fragmented storefront signals.

Data mapping and inventory ownership logic

The integration relies on your storefront as the primary source for sales velocity and Prediko as the engine for demand generation. Fulfil acts as the system of record for inventory counts and purchasing. Data flows from the storefront into Prediko for analysis, where forecasts are matched against stock levels pulled from Fulfil. We focus on data integrity for item mapping, ensuring that promotional fluctuations and returns are handled correctly to avoid skewing the demand base. Monitoring is embedded at each step to surface issues like data mismatches or sync delays before they result in incorrect purchase orders. This ensures the forecasting model stays aligned with the physical reality of the warehouse.

Integration operating model

This operating model defines how planning and execution systems interact to stop purchasing errors. Sales data flows into Prediko to update the demand curve, which is cross-referenced against live inventory and open purchase orders in Fulfil. This creates a unified forecast for purchasing requirements. Fulfil remains the source of truth for warehouse activity and financial records, while Prediko acts as the specialised layer for stock optimisation. This separation of concerns ensures the ERP manages the transactions while the planning tool operates on validated inventory data. It replaces fragmented spreadsheets with an automated purchasing workflow where signals are derived from actual sales velocity rather than static historical averages.

Common failures

Forecasts based on unvetted sales data

Operational impact: If Prediko's forecasts include cancelled or fraudulent orders from Shopify, the calculated sales velocity becomes artificially inflated. This results in the purchasing team creating Purchase Orders in Fulfil for stock that is not required, tying up working capital in excess inventory. The finance team's subsequent analysis will reveal discrepancies between forecasted sales and actual revenue, undermining trust in the forecasting data.

Prevention / Action: The integration logic must be designed to filter sales data before it is passed to Prediko. A pre-processing step should validate orders against a 'paid' financial status and an 'unfulfilled' status in Shopify, explicitly excluding any sales orders marked as 'cancelled' or 'refunded'. This establishes a clear source-of-truth for valid sales and ensures purchasing decisions are based on clean, reliable demand signals.

SKU and master data inconsistencies

Operational impact: When SKUs on Shopify sales orders do not exactly match the corresponding item records in Fulfil, Prediko cannot correctly attribute demand. This creates orphaned forecasts, leading to stockouts on fast-moving products or erroneous purchasing against incorrect items. Operations and merchandising teams are then forced to spend significant time manually reconciling SKU-level sales data against Fulfil's item master.

Prevention / Action: Establish Fulfil as the single source of truth for all product and item master data. The integration programme must enforce SKU discipline, ensuring any new SKU is created in Fulfil first before being published to Shopify. Implement exception handling in the integration to flag and quarantine any sales order lines with unrecognised SKUs, preventing them from polluting the forecast until the data is corrected in the source system.

Inbound stock latency

Operational impact: Prediko's ability to accurately forecast necessary purchase quantities is dependent on timely data about inbound stock. If new or updated Purchase Orders from Fulfil are slow to sync, Prediko's engine will assume lower future availability and shorter stock cover. This prompts the system to recommend premature or excessive re-orders, creating a bullwhip effect that inflates inventory holding costs.

Prevention / Action: The integration should be configured to poll Fulfil for 'Confirmed' and 'In-Transit' Purchase Order statuses on a frequent, defined schedule. The process design must map these statuses correctly to the data structure Prediko expects for calculating future stock availability. Monitoring should be established to alert the operations team if the Purchase Order sync job fails or its latency exceeds an agreed threshold.

Ignoring non-sales inventory movements

Operational impact: Warehouse teams perform manual stock adjustments in Fulfil to account for damages, quality control failures, or cycle count corrections. If these events do not update the inventory level presented to Prediko, its baseline stock data becomes inaccurate. This causes the forecasting engine to make recommendations based on incorrect stock levels, leading to either stockouts or the ordering of unnecessary buffer stock.

Prevention / Action: Design the integration to treat Fulfil as the definitive source of truth for the 'stock on hand' balance. Do not rely solely on decrementing stock based on Shopify sales. The integration should include a scheduled job, typically running daily, that pulls the absolute inventory level for every SKU from Fulfil to true-up the baseline data used by Prediko for all its forecasting calculations.

Frequently asked questions

We are constantly stocking out of bestsellers but are overstocked on other items. How does this correct that?

This problem often arises when demand forecasts are disconnected from procurement. By using Prediko to analyse real sales velocity and connecting it to Fulfil, you align your purchasing with actual demand. This ensures purchase orders for your fast-moving SKUs are placed proactively based on projected demand, while preventing over-buying of slow-moving items.

Do cancelled orders or returns negatively affect our demand forecast?

Yes, this is a common failure point if not handled correctly. Prediko's forecasts can be inflated if they include sales data from cancelled or fully refunded orders, leading to inaccurate purchasing recommendations in Fulfil. A core part of the integration process is to establish rules that filter these orders, ensuring that purchase orders are based only on legitimate sales.

How does the integration handle forecasting for product bundles or kits?

Prediko's engine is built for a flat SKU structure, which can create forecasting challenges when Fulfil manages complex bundles made of multiple component SKUs. A successful implementation requires a clear data strategy to map sales of a bundle SKU back to its individual components. This ensures purchasing decisions in Fulfil accurately reflect the underlying demand for each item.

Our forecasts become unreliable after promotions. How does connecting Prediko and Fulfil help?

Prediko can analyse historical sales data to model the impact of promotions on demand for specific SKUs, separating promotional uplift from baseline sales. By feeding this enriched forecast into Fulfil, you can ensure purchase orders are raised to meet promotional demand without causing post-sale overstocking. This prevents stockouts during a sale and protects margins afterwards.
